See this document in CiteSeerX!

Isabelle HOL The Tutorial (1998)  (Make Corrections)  (3 citations)
Tobias Nipkow



  Home/Search   Context   Related

 
View or download:
www4.informatik.tumuenchen...HOL.ps.gz
Cached:  PS.gz  PS  PDF   Image  Update  Help

From:  diku.dk/users/skal...bibliography (more)
(Enter author homepages)

Rate this article: (best)
  Comment on this article  
(Enter summary)

Abstract: ion over pairs and tuples is merely a convenient shorthand for a more complex internal representation. Thus the internal and external form of a term may differ, which can affect proofs. If you want to avoid this complication, use fst and snd, i.e. write %p. fst p + snd p instead of %(x,y). x + y. See x?? for theorem proving with tuple patterns. CHAPTER 2. FUNCTIONAL PROGRAMMING IN HOL 18 2.6 Definitions A definition is simply an abbreviation, i.e. a new name for an existing construction. In ... (Update)

Context of citations to this paper:   More

...proof of the corresponding recursion theorem is the most dicult part of this work. Even though Isabelle has a sophisticated recdef mechanism [NP] for recursive de nitions with user supplied well founded relation or a measure function to justify termination, this method is dicult...

...order logic using equivalence sets. 1 Introduction In theorem proving systems for higher order logics such as HOL [GM93] Isabelle [NPW02] and PVS [ORR 96] tools are provided that automatically generate the theorems and de nitions necessary to add inductive (or recursive)...

Cited by:   More
Verifying BDD Algorithms through Monadic Interpretation - Krstic, Matthews (2002)   (Correct)
Inductive data types with negative occurrences in HOL - Vos, Swierstra (2002)   (Correct)

Similar documents (at the sentence level):
54.2%:   Isabelle HOL - The Tutorial - Nipkow (1999)   (Correct)

Active bibliography (related documents):   More   All
0.5:   Winskel is (almost) Right - Towards a Mechanized Semantics Textbook - Nipkow (1998)   (Correct)
0.0:   Computer Arithmetic: Logic, Calculation, and Rewriting - Benini, Nowotka, Pulley (1998)   (Correct)
0.0:   Representing FM in Isabelle - Blok (1994)   (Correct)

Similar documents based on text:   More   All
0.6:   Isabelle's Logics: HOL - Nipkow, Paulson, Wenzel (2000)   (Correct)
0.5:   Java Source and Bytecode Formalizations in Isabelle.. - Klein, Nipkow, von.. (2002)   (Correct)
0.4:   Owicki/Gries in Isabelle/HOL - Nipkow, Nieto (1999)   (Correct)

Related documents from co-citation:   More   All
2:   Another look at nested recursion (context) - Slind
2:   University of Cambridge Computer Laboratory (context) - Norrish, in et al. - 1998
2:   Computer Standards and Interfaces (context) - Papaspyrou, of - 2001

BibTeX entry:   (Update)

T. Nipkow and L. Paulson. Isabelle/HOL tutorial. http://citeseer.ist.psu.edu/nipkow98isabelle.html   More

@misc{ nipkow-isabelle,
  author = "Tobias Nipkow",
  title = "Isabelle HOL - The Tutorial",
  text = "T. Nipkow and L. Paulson. Isabelle/HOL tutorial.",
  url = "citeseer.ist.psu.edu/nipkow98isabelle.html" }
Citations (may not include all citations):
362   ML for the Working Programmer (context) - Paulson - 1996
333   Introduction to Functional Programming (context) - Bird, Wadler - 1988
249   Volume 3: Sorting and Searching (context) - Knuth, of - 1975
51   The Isabelle Reference Manual - Paulson
43   Logic and Computation (context) - Paulson - 1987
31   Isabelle's Object-Logics - Paulson
2   and Oskar Slotosch (context) - Muller, Nipkow et al. - 1998

Documents on the same site (http://www.diku.dk/users/skalberg/papers/bibliography.html):   More
All Structured Programs have Small Tree-Width and Good Register.. - Thorup (1998)   (Correct)
PVS Prover Guide - Version 2.2 - Shankar, Owre, Rushby..   (Correct)
The Call-by-Need Lambda Calculus - Maraist, Odersky (1994)   (Correct)

Online articles have much greater impact   More about CiteSeer.IST   Add search form to your site   Submit documents   Feedback  

CiteSeer.IST - Copyright Penn State and NEC